Strasbourg - Saint-Denis is a station of the Paris Métro, serving line 4, line 8, and line 9.
This station was formerly called Boulevard Saint-Denis. It is named for rue Saint-Denis, commemorating Saint Denis, the first bishop of Paris and patron saint of France, and for boulevard de Strasbourg, so called because it leads to the Gare de l'Est whence trains to Strasbourg depart.
